About EMMT-Based out of Nelson, British Columbia, Elephant Mountain Music Theatre strives to bring major productions to local theatres, starring local talent.
EMMT started in the fall of 2013, with its first production being "La Vie Boheme". This show brought in musical talent from across Canada, all leading up to the spring 2014 production of Jonathan Larson's Tony Award-winning Broadway hit, "Rent". EMMT has been awarded a Columbia Basin Trust grant to tour this production in the East Kootenays in November 2014. About the show-Rent is a rock musical loosely based on Puccini's opera La boheme. It tells the story of a year in the life of a group of impoverished young artists in 1989 New York City. They are dealing with poverty, addiction, and harsh personal truths at the height of the AIDS epidemic. The story captures the highs and lows of their lives as they realize their "actual reality".
The musical was first seen in a limited three-week workshop production in New York in 1994. The production opened at the New York Theatre Workshop on January 25, 1996. The show's creator, Jonathan Larson, died suddenly of an aortic dissection the night before the off-Broadway premiere. The show won a Pulitzer Prize for Best Drama in 1996, and the show was a hit. The production moved into Broadway's larger Nederlander Theatre in April of the same year. On Broadway, Rent gained critical acclaim and won four Tony Awards, among other awards. The Broadway production closed on September 7, 2008 after a 12-year fun of 5123 performances. Rent was the tenth longest-running Broadway show at the time. The success of the show led to several national tours and numerous foreign productions. In 2005, it was adapted into a motion picture featuring most of the original cast members.
